Research Abstract

Aptamers are single strand DNA and RNA oligonucleotides binding to their target with high affinity by three-dimensional conformation of aptamers. In this study, we report development of the high sensitively assay utilizing the aptamer for oxytocin, is associated to autism spectrum. As a result, various aptamers for oxytocin were generated by using RNA and DNA on SELEX. Those aptamers for oxytocin have checked to evaluate the affinity with oxytocin.
